It is normal to have the occasional cold or sinus infection. However, when sinus infections occur multiple times a year or symptoms last longer than 12 weeks, it may be classified as chronic sinusitis.
Chronic sinusitis can cause facial pressure, congestion, thick nasal drainage, post nasal drip, fatigue, and reduced sense of smell. Many patients try repeated courses of antibiotics without lasting relief.
An evaluation with an ENT specialist can help determine the root cause. Structural concerns, nasal polyps, allergies, and inflammation can all contribute. Treatment options range from medical management to minimally invasive procedures such as balloon sinuplasty.
